⚙️ Anwendung & Montage

Diese LHW-Feder wird auf der rechten Torseite (innen betrachtet) montiert. Sie gleicht das Gewicht des Torblatts präzise aus und sorgt für gleichmäßigen, sicheren Lauf. Durch Vormontage ist der Einbau besonders einfach und sicher.

Sicherheits-Tipp: Nur mit passendem Spannwerkzeug (Ø 12,7 mm) und Schutzausrüstung montieren. Antrieb spannungsfrei schalten. Tormeister 24 empfiehlt Installation durch qualifizierte Fachkräfte zur Gewährleistung der Arbeitssicherheit.

❓ FAQ

Was bedeutet LHW?

LHW steht für „Left Hand Wound“ – linksgewickelt. Diese Feder wird bei Doppelfedersystemen auf der rechten Seite (innen betrachtet) montiert.

Wie erkenne ich die richtige Wicklungsrichtung?

LHW-Federn (linksgewickelt) sind für die rechte Torseite vorgesehen, RHW-Federn (rechtsgewickelt) für die linke Torseite – immer von innen gesehen.

Wie lange hält eine Torsionsfeder?

Bei richtiger Montage und Pflege sind bis zu 25.000 Öffnungszyklen möglich. Regelmäßige Inspektion verlängert die Lebensdauer erheblich.
